Pros

Solid benefits for standard 401K & matching, healthcare and time off. They offer unique benefits if the company does well each quarter such as food trucks, massages or catered lunch. They also have music lessons for those interested and a stocked kitchen full of snacks. On the work side, if you like overseas Contract Manufacturing and trade shows, there are lots of opportuities to go to those in any role in the company. Sales team on site are solid and offer great insight of customer requirements and understanding of product. They also have a strong culture of encouraging engagement with customer in all roles so you end up meeting and getting to know alot of your customers both on thr job and at their home. You will genuinely understand your customer. In a small company you will learn alot by having many roles from marketing to engineering to quality. Also a con depending on perspective. They provide quarterly self reflection meetings with guest speakers as team building excercises. They invest in you if your interested in furthering education either formally for through certification programs. This companys values and culture is to serve the HVACR community. That mission is clear from your first day of work.

Cons

They keep and promote toxic people that are a cancer to the company and coworkers. For a small company this quickly demoralizes the team and new hires. Contract Manufacturing means you will be making video calls overseas alot, at all hours of the night and day troubleshooting problems. Small company means you will take on many roles. Expect to work with all departments and in many roles. Also a Pro depending on perspective. There is an ambition to grow and adopt big company design, sales, and leadership methodologies (albiet they are often outdated or not relavant to this industry or size of company) but this is done so without buy in from the team. Many lessons from consultants and speakers are quickly forgotten or willfully ignored especially by a few toxic co workers. The toxic coworkers, funny enough, get promoted by not having to come to work on site, work at any hours they please, show up to meetings late and have no consequences for bad behavior or bad attitude. The most toxic coworker will openly insult you and your colleagues in the middle of meeting in front of management after showing up late. All the benefits and pay in the world cannot compensate for having to work with people like this. Few core member from original fieldpiece company are still left that are a wealth of knowledge and experience. But there is major issues with retention from new hires.

Pros

* Positive business outlook. Due to HVAC regulations, a lot of opportunities for new product innovation * Robust stage gate product development process. * Disciplined market research practices to fully understand customer pain points and applications. Fieldpiece build products for the customer, not what the CEO or leadership wants (like some other company). Top reason why I took the job in the first place. * Strong appreciation for customer focus innovation that really solve field tech pain points. * HVAC techs are fanatical about Fieldpiece products, nice to be in that position. * Generous and flexible PTO policy. Set days PTO days for vacation, sick and holiday. So if you don't want to celebrate a holiday, you can save it and use it as PTO. * Generous monthly bonus if we meet forecast and holiday bonus.

Cons

* Many of the core employees want to retain the Fieldpiece culture. But not conducive to company growth. * Lack many processes and ZERO appreciation for defined roles and responsibilities. Middle management should do better in this area. RACI charts are rare here. And initiatives and process changes are not cascade down to teams. For such a small company, inter departmental communication is not great. * Many team members aren't very collaborative, not because they don't want to, they just don't know better. I would rate cross-functional collaboration a 5 out of 10 (10 as best). *There are some REALLY TOXIC, UNPROFESSIONAL employee behavior that shocked me. Very abrasive, non respectful communication styles. * Slow pace culture, great for work life balance I guess.
